Caroline “Marie” McLachlan was born on the 14th day, the 4th month, of 1940. This is how Mom always explained when her birthday was! She was the oldest child of Frank and Gertie Irwin. She grew up on the farm near Clashmoor. She attended the Girwood School 2 miles south of their farm. The Irwins also had a service station/general store and Mom helped with pumping gas, etc. She also was the big sister to 6 siblings, so was a great help to her mother with all the daily chores.


One day when Mom was about 14-15, a good looking young man by the name of Dee, stopped in for gas. And so began a friendship. Mom moved to Arborfield when she was 16 and worked in the Arborfield Cafe and continued to date Dee. They were married on August 1, 1958. They started out married life in Arborfield, then moved to the Irwin farm 10 miles South of Arborfield and began their farming career.


Marie and Dee raised three children, Marlene (1959), Donald (1961), and David (1964). A number of years later, as their children each married, their family grew to three more! Mom, in her last few weeks, was very happy to tell everyone that she had six children. Over time, nine grandchildren came along, then spouses were added, and 14 great grandchildren. Every last one in every generation was truly loved by Mom.


Dave and Michelle joined Mom and Dad in the farming operation. Mom and Dad moved to their big home in Tisdale in 1991, allowing Dave and Michelle to move to the farm and raise their family. They downsized to a condo in Tisdale in 2018.


Mom was a homemaker, through and through! She was a wonderful and loving wife, mother, grandma and great-grandma. She could whip up a meal, sew a dress, drive the grain truck with kids sleeping on the floor, pull start the auger engine, grow a huge garden and pick raspberries by the bucket, drive the school bus, was always “on call”. Her house and yard were always well kept! THEN, she got to work at the Fabric Basket, which she truly enjoyed!


Marie and Dee heard and embraced the gospel in 1965. They valued the fellowship and care they had over the years since then.


Mom was predeceased by her husband, Dee; sister, Bertha; brother, John; great granddaughter, Danika.


She is survived by her children, Marlene (Don), Don (Barb), and Dave (Michelle); 9 grandchildren

and spouses, and 14 great grandchildren; sister, Eileen (George); brothers, Ken,

Earl (Sherry), Gerald (Gwyn); sister-in-law, Irene; as well as many extended family and friends.
